Description:
We are seeking applicants who, within the context of the role responsibilities, possess the following key attributes:
- Detailed knowledge and understanding of contemporary issues impacting on the delivery of ambulance services and experience in the provision of effective asset management services in an ambulance environment.- Proven effective administrative skills with a demonstrated high level ability in the use of software packages such as Excel and SAP, and the ability to acquire knowledge of other software.- Demonstrated well developed communication and interpersonal skills, including the ability to liaise, consult and negotiate effectively with people at all levels within the department and with external stakeholders.- Highly developed conceptual, problem solving and analytical skills including a demonstrated ability to interpret financial and trend/output/outcome performance data to drive performance improvement.- Demonstrated commitment to implement practices which promote a fair and ethical workplace, employment equity, cultural diversity and occupational health and safety.
The following mandatory requirements, special conditions and/or other requirements apply to this role:
- Whilst not mandatory, qualifications in administration or business-related disciplines would be well regarded.
